  10. 62.  Hugh Fitton was born in of Bolyn, Cheshire, England (son of Richard Fitton and Ellen); died before 1270.

    Notes:

    "Hugh Phiton or Fyton had a grant of Rushton and Eaton, with various privileges, from John Scot earl of Chester; but this grant being voided by felony, (by which we are probably to understand the uncompromised result of one of the affrays common in that turbulent period,) the said manors were re-granted to John de Gray." [Ormerod, citation details below.]
